Ingredients: The Elements of the Pink Dream
To ensure the most vibrant flavor and color, the quality of your strawberry syrup and chocolate is paramount.
- 2 Cups Whole Milk: The liquid foundation. Whole milk provides the proteins needed for a stable, frothy foam.
- 1/2 Cup Heavy Cream: The secret regulator for a thick, indulgent, “velvet” consistency.
- 1/2 Cup White Chocolate Chips: These provide the sweetness and the cocoa-butter body.
- 1/3 Cup Strawberry Syrup: The primary aromatic and coloring agent.
- 1/2 Teaspoon Vanilla Extract: Rounds out the sweetness with a familiar floral finish.
- Garnishments: Whipped cream, fresh berries, and shavings for textural variety.
